There are several kinds of stationary bikes available on the marketplace, each created to deal with different fitness levels and choices. Below is a summary of the main types:
TypeDescriptionIdeal ForUpright BikeFunctions a standard bike design. The rider sits upright.People looking for a practical biking experience.Recumbent BikeProvides a reclined seating position with a bigger seat and back support.Those with back concerns or those seeking comfort throughout workouts.Spin BikeSimilar to an upright bike but created for high-intensity training.Fitness lovers and those wishing to simulate outdoor cycling.Dual Action BikeConsists of handlebars that move, providing an upper body workout as well.People looking for a full-body workout.2. Advantages of Using a Stationary Bike
Utilizing a stationary bike for exercise provides many advantages for physical health and general wellness. Some of the essential advantages include:
Cardiovascular Fitness: Regular cycling strengthens the heart, enhances flow, and increases aerobic capacity.Weight Management: Stationary biking assists burn calories and preserve a healthy weight.Joint-Friendly: Cycling is a low-impact exercise, making it suitable for individuals with joint discomfort or injuries.Convenience: A stationary bicycle can be used indoors, enabling workouts regardless of weather.Personalization: Most stationary bicycles use adjustable resistance levels, accommodating different fitness levels.3. Tips for Effective Cycling Workouts
To optimize your stationary bicycle exercises, consider the following pointers:
Warm Up: Start with a 5-10 minute warm-up at a low resistance level before increasing strength.Stay Hydrated: Keep a water bottle close-by and take sips throughout your exercise.Vary Your Workouts: Incorporate interval training by rotating between high-intensity bursts and healing periods.Listen to Music or Watch Television: Engaging your mind can help make exercises more enjoyable and disruptive.Track Your Progress: Keep a log of your exercises and note improvements over time to stay inspired.5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long should I use a stationary bike for effective workouts?
For ideal outcomes, goal for 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ity weekly, which can be divided into 30-minute sessions 5 times a week.
2. Are stationary bicycles suitable for newbies?
Yes, stationary bicycles are best for beginners due to their adjustable resistance and low-impact nature, making them easy to utilize at any fitness level.
3. Can stationary cycling aid with weight reduction?
Absolutely! Regular usage of a stationary bike, combined with a well balanced diet plan, can considerably add to weight loss efforts by burning calories.
4. What should I wear when using a stationary bike?
Wear comfortable, moisture-wicking clothing and helpful athletic shoes to ensure an enjoyable exercise experience.
5. Is it better to use a stationary bicycle or a treadmill for cardio?
It depends on individual choice and fitness objectives. Stationary bikes are lower impact and much easier on the joints, whereas treadmills can offer weight-bearing exercises that might boost bone health.
